Deep Dive: How Payment Card Networks Win Merchants Over

PYMNTS

This is thanks to a 2010 federal law known as the Durbin Amendment, which requires that merchants be able to select from at least two unaffiliated networks through which they can route their transactions. Debit cards secured with PINs came into wide use in the 1990s, and regional card networks often processed such payments at the time.
